> A reminder that the Fedora 22 Virt Test Day is this coming Thu Apr 16. Check
> out the test day landing page:
>
> https://fedoraproject.org/wiki/Test_Day:2015-04-16_Virtualization
>
> It's a great time to make sure your virt workflow is still working correctly
> with the latest packages in Fedora 22. No requirement to run through test
> cases on the wiki, just show up and let us know what works (or breaks).
>
> Updating to a development release of Fedora scares some people, but it's NOT
> required to help out with the test day: you can test the latest virt bits on
> the latest Fedora release courtesy of the virt-preview repo. For more details,
> as well as easy instructions on updating to Fedora 22, see:
>
> https://fedoraproject.org/wiki/Test_Day:2015-04-16_Virtualization#What.27s_needed_to_test
>
> Though running latest Fedora 22 on a physical machine is still preferred :)
